summaryrefslogtreecommitdiffstats
path: root/edify
diff options
context:
space:
mode:
authorTianjie Xu <xunchang@google.com>2019-05-25 01:08:45 +0200
committerTianjie Xu <xunchang@google.com>2019-06-24 21:46:28 +0200
commitd118833f3e55f94d1dad416c6facddb3e2d48297 (patch)
tree243fd7f70609ed48db16afc298e2659e77b0059b /edify
parentMerge "Support starting fuse from a block map" (diff)
downloadandroid_bootable_recovery-d118833f3e55f94d1dad416c6facddb3e2d48297.tar
android_bootable_recovery-d118833f3e55f94d1dad416c6facddb3e2d48297.tar.gz
android_bootable_recovery-d118833f3e55f94d1dad416c6facddb3e2d48297.tar.bz2
android_bootable_recovery-d118833f3e55f94d1dad416c6facddb3e2d48297.tar.lz
android_bootable_recovery-d118833f3e55f94d1dad416c6facddb3e2d48297.tar.xz
android_bootable_recovery-d118833f3e55f94d1dad416c6facddb3e2d48297.tar.zst
android_bootable_recovery-d118833f3e55f94d1dad416c6facddb3e2d48297.zip
Diffstat (limited to 'edify')
-rw-r--r--edify/include/edify/updater_runtime_interface.h7
1 files changed, 6 insertions, 1 deletions
diff --git a/edify/include/edify/updater_runtime_interface.h b/edify/include/edify/updater_runtime_interface.h
index 15ccd832d..d3d26da64 100644
--- a/edify/include/edify/updater_runtime_interface.h
+++ b/edify/include/edify/updater_runtime_interface.h
@@ -66,4 +66,9 @@ class UpdaterRuntimeInterface {
// Runs tune2fs with arguments |args|.
virtual int Tune2Fs(const std::vector<std::string>& args) const = 0;
-}; \ No newline at end of file
+
+ // Dynamic partition related functions.
+ virtual bool MapPartitionOnDeviceMapper(const std::string& partition_name, std::string* path) = 0;
+ virtual bool UnmapPartitionOnDeviceMapper(const std::string& partition_name) = 0;
+ virtual bool UpdateDynamicPartitions(const std::string_view op_list_value) = 0;
+};